T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
Power Supply 120V, 60Hz
Motor Capacity 13A
No-load Speed 5,300RPM
Diamond Cutting Wheel Size 7” Dia.X5/8” (Bore)
Maximum Depth Cut at 0° 2-3/8”
Maximum Depth Cut at 45° 1-1/4”
Tilting Range 0°,22.5°,45°
Maximum Rip Cut 24”
Maximum Square Tile of Diagonal 18”
